Overview of Samsung 4K TVs

 
 

Samsung 4K TVs give you a resolution of 3840 × 2160 pixels — four times the detail of Full HD. You see sharper text, finer textures, and more depth in every scene, whether you are streaming on Netflix or watching live cricket.


All models run on Samsung's Tizen OS, which gives you access to OTT apps, Samsung TV Plus (100+ free live channels), SmartThings smart home control, and voice commands through Bixby and Alexa. Samsung Knox Security is built in to protect your data.

Which is the best Samsung 4K TV for an immersive movie experience?

If movies are your priority, the answer depends on your budget.


  • Best under Rs. 45,000 — Samsung Crystal 4K Infinity Vision (55-inch)

The Samsung Crystal 4K Infinity Vision UA55UE84AFULXL (55-inch, 4K Ultra HD, Tizen, Slim Look design) is priced at ₹43,990 on Flipkart. It comes with PurColor technology for natural tones, HDR 10+ for better highlight detail, and 4K Upscaling (Crystal Processor 4K) so non-4K content also looks sharper. The Adaptive Sound feature adjusts audio based on what is on screen. For a dimly lit living room, this is a solid choice at its price.


  • Best for a true cinematic experience — Samsung QLED or Neo QLED

If your budget stretches further, the QLED series adds a Quantum Dot sheet that delivers 100% colour volume — meaning colours stay accurate even at peak brightness. The QLED does not suffer from the same colour washout that LED panels can show at high brightness. For a dark home theatre setup, the Neo QLED (mini-LED, available in the 2026 Vision AI series) goes further with more precise local dimming zones for better black levels.


Trade-off note: The Crystal 4K series lacks local dimming. In a very dark room, you may notice light bleed around bright objects on a dark background. This is a property of edge-lit LED panels, not a defect. If black levels matter to you, a QLED or Neo QLED model at a higher price point is worth the upgrade.

Trade-off note: The Crystal 4K series caps at 60 Hz on most models. If you want to use your Samsung TV as a gaming display with smooth motion at 120 Hz, you will need to move up to the Neo QLED or Vision AI range. The higher refresh rate (120 Hz) halves the motion blur you see in fast games or sports — but it also increases the price significantly.

What is the difference between a Smart TV and a 4K TV?

A 4K TV refers to the screen resolution — 3840 × 2160 pixels. It describes what the panel can display, not how the TV connects to the internet or runs apps. A Smart TV refers to the operating system on board. A Smart TV connects to Wi-Fi, runs streaming apps like Netflix and YouTube, and responds to voice commands. It is about software and connectivity, not picture quality.


Samsung's Crystal 4K range is both. Every model in the Crystal 4K Infinity Vision lineup is a Smart TV running Tizen OS. You get 4K resolution AND Smart TV features — OTT apps, Samsung TV Plus free channels, voice control, SmartThings home connectivity — in a single device.

The only scenario where you might buy a 4K TV that is not a Smart TV is a budget screen used purely as a gaming monitor or a secondary display. For home entertainment in India in 2026, you will almost always want both.
